Cottonwood Technology Fund
Cottonwood Technology Fund is a deep tech venture capital fund that invests in hard science and deep tech startups in the Southwest US and Northern Europe. The fund focuses on patent-based hard science and deep tech startups in various fields, including photonics, optics, micro- & nanoelectronics, advanced materials, nanotechnology, health sciences, climate tech, sensor technology, robotics, and advanced manufacturing.

Tramway Ventures: Investment Strategy
Tramway Ventures is an investment firm in New Mexico that focuses on breakthrough technologies and R&D. They invest in companies in the first institutional round after incubators and angel investors, with a target audience of New Mexico-based companies that require less than $30 million in total capital to exit.

New Mexico LEEP (Lab Embedded Entrepreneur Program)
New Mexico LEEP is a two-year program that connects entrepreneurs with funding, mentors, customers, and investors from Los Alamos and Sandia national laboratories. It offers resources, webinars, collaborations, and partnerships to individuals with tech-compatible ideas, aiming to foster innovation and entrepreneurship in New Mexico.

New Mexico Bioscience Authority (NMBSA)
The New Mexico Bioscience Authority (NMBSA) is a public-private partnership that connects research, investment, and entrepreneurs to support the growth of the bioscience industry in New Mexico. They offer programs and resources to attract businesses, facilitate knowledge sharing, and provide funding opportunities for bioscience companies.
